    Paris School of Economics (PSE) MSc in Finance

    The Paris School of Economics (PSE) MSc in Finance program is renowned for its rigorous academic approach and strong focus on quantitative finance. If you're a math whiz or someone who loves digging into complex models, this program might be right up your alley. The curriculum is designed to provide a deep understanding of financial theory and its applications in the real world. You'll learn from world-class faculty members who are leading researchers in their fields. PSE's location in Paris, a global financial hub, also offers numerous opportunities for internships and networking. Moreover, the program emphasizes econometrics, statistical analysis, and mathematical modeling. This provides a robust foundation for tackling sophisticated financial problems. A distinctive feature is the blend of theoretical learning with practical applications, facilitated through case studies and real-world projects. This ensures that graduates are well-prepared to enter demanding roles in finance. The PSE MSc in Finance aims to cultivate leaders who can adeptly navigate the complexities of the financial landscape. Students delve into asset pricing, corporate finance, and market microstructure, among other areas. Furthermore, the program incorporates guest lectures and workshops with industry professionals, providing invaluable insights into current market trends and practices. Overall, PSE's MSc in Finance is ideally suited for individuals seeking a challenging and intellectually stimulating educational experience.

    Oxford Saïd Business School (OSC) MSc in Financial Economics

    The Oxford Saïd Business School (OSC) MSc in Financial Economics program offers a unique blend of finance and economics, providing a holistic view of the financial world. Situated within the prestigious University of Oxford, this program attracts bright minds from around the globe. The curriculum is designed to equip students with the analytical and quantitative skills needed to succeed in today's dynamic financial markets. You'll explore topics such as asset pricing, corporate finance, and financial econometrics, all while benefiting from the expertise of leading academics and industry practitioners. What sets OSC apart is its emphasis on real-world applications and its strong connection to the financial industry. The program incorporates case studies, simulations, and guest lectures, providing students with valuable insights into the practical aspects of finance. Moreover, Oxford's vibrant academic community and its proximity to London, a major financial center, offer unparalleled networking and career opportunities. The MSc in Financial Economics at Oxford Saïd aims to provide students with a thorough understanding of both theoretical and practical aspects of finance. The program encourages critical thinking and problem-solving, preparing students for leadership roles. In addition to core coursework, students have the opportunity to specialize in areas such as investment management, risk management, and financial regulation. The program also emphasizes ethical considerations in finance, encouraging students to make responsible and sustainable decisions.

    ESSEC Business School MSc in Finance

    ESSEC Business School MSc in Finance is a top-ranked program known for its international focus and its strong ties to the corporate world. If you're looking for a program that will prepare you for a global career in finance, ESSEC might be the perfect fit. The curriculum is designed to provide a comprehensive understanding of financial theory and practice, with a strong emphasis on innovation and entrepreneurship. You'll learn from experienced faculty members who have a wealth of industry knowledge, and you'll have the opportunity to network with leading companies through internships, company visits, and guest lectures. ESSEC's location in Paris, a vibrant and cosmopolitan city, also offers a rich cultural experience. ESSEC's MSc in Finance distinguishes itself through its focus on integrating academic rigor with practical industry insights. The program provides specialized tracks in areas such as financial markets, corporate finance, and financial engineering. It also incorporates various experiential learning opportunities, including case studies, simulations, and real-world consulting projects. ESSEC places a strong emphasis on developing soft skills, such as communication and teamwork, which are crucial for success in the finance industry. The program also offers opportunities for international exchange programs, allowing students to gain exposure to different cultures and business environments. ESSEC Business School also has a solid alumni network, with graduates holding leadership positions in companies around the world.

    ESCP Business School MSc in Finance

    ESCP Business School MSc in Finance is a highly regarded program that offers a unique multi-campus experience. With campuses in several European cities, including Paris, London, and Berlin, ESCP provides students with an unparalleled opportunity to immerse themselves in different cultures and business environments. The curriculum is designed to provide a rigorous and comprehensive understanding of financial theory and practice, with a strong emphasis on international finance. You'll learn from a diverse faculty of academics and industry professionals, and you'll have the opportunity to network with students and alumni from around the world. ESCP's MSc in Finance program distinguishes itself through its emphasis on practical learning and its global perspective. The program incorporates case studies, simulations, and company visits, providing students with valuable insights into the real-world challenges facing financial institutions. Moreover, ESCP's multi-campus structure allows students to tailor their learning experience to their specific interests and career goals. The program fosters a collaborative and multicultural learning environment, encouraging students to share their perspectives and learn from each other. ESCP Business School also has a strong alumni network, with graduates holding leadership positions in companies around the globe.

    Key Differences and Similarities

    So, what are the key differences and similarities between these four amazing MSc Finance programs? Let's break it down, guys!

    • Focus: PSE is heavily quantitative, OSC blends finance with economics, ESSEC emphasizes innovation and corporate ties, and ESCP offers a multi-campus, international experience.
    • Location: All four schools are located in major European cities, offering access to vibrant cultural scenes and financial hubs. PSE, ESSEC, and ESCP are in Paris, while OSC is in Oxford with easy access to London.
    • Curriculum: All four programs cover core finance topics, but they differ in their emphasis on specific areas such as econometrics, financial economics, innovation, and international finance.
    • Career Opportunities: Graduates from all four programs are highly sought after by employers in the finance industry, but the specific career paths may vary depending on the program's focus and location.
    • Network: All four schools have strong alumni networks, but the geographical reach and industry focus may differ.
